RODRIGUES, Romir de Oliveira. Bitting the Red Apple: Ideology, Hegemony and School Practices in the Initial Work from Michael Apple. Pedagogía y Saberes [online]. 2017, n.46, pp.85-95. ISSN 0121-2494.
This article presents some reflections on methodological approaches incorporated into the Doctoral Research Project "On Curupira's Path: the National Program for Access to Technical Education and Employment and the Public-private Relations" in development at the Federal University of Rio Grande do Sul. It seeks to analyze the initial Michael Apple trilogy, in order to investigate the conception of ideology and hegemony and how those categories contribute to the understanding of the internal relations between schools and their relations to society. Observing schools as active spaces, crossed by contradictions and conflicts and founded on a dialectical relation between production and reproduction, Apple reaffirms that schools are spaces of dispute and, therefore, of possibilities.
